Stations and earthquakes
PTJ: 2004-2010, 70 earthquakesZAG: 2001-2010, 71 earthquakes
Δ < 120 km, ML ≥ 2.0, h < 30 km

Procedure
tWL = time window length (30 s)
tL = lapse time → shifted
windowstS = S-wave travel time
fl (Hz) f (Hz) fu (Hz)
1 1.5 2
2 3 4
4 6 8
6 9 12
8 12 16
12 18 24
16 24 32
Band-pass filters [fl,fu] and central frequencies f

lnPGA475 vs. Q0 → 11 stations: coastal region + Zagreb area
tL (s) R (km) ρ p
40 76 -0.80 95%
50 95 -0.92 95%
60 114 -0.86 95%
70 133 -0.82 95%
80 152 -0.49 85%
ρ = correlation coefficient
p = statistically significant confidence level
PGA475 = peak ground acceleration for the return period of 475 yr at the
station site
R = radius equivalent to tL for average vs = 3.8 km/s

Conclusions
o Q0 and n indicate highly heterogeneous medium
o Coda-Q is lapse time dependent
o A marked change of Q0 and n at about 100 km depth (upper mantle)
o Different choice of f0 might “eliminate” lapse time dependence of Qc
o Very convincing correlation between Q0 and PGA475 (seismicity)
